Output 5114b3c474f1954b4a5d6a7ca21f0dfc8b255c581385b9eedc58362fa5bfbced:66

value
299950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7592e0e3cac8fe721a0b6c61a29b2fb7e0cc40 OP_EQUAL
address
3QXKhfiSzRMjW2wULrwqQDHzeFpkV9yhZV
transaction
5114b3c474f1954b4a5d6a7ca21f0dfc8b255c581385b9eedc58362fa5bfbced
spent
true